The STGAubron Gaming PC Desktop combines an Intel Core i7 processor (up to 3.9GHz), N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 12GB graphics, 32GB RAM, and a 1TB SSD to deliver high-performance computing for gaming, streaming, and professional workloads. Featuring WiFi 6, Bluetooth 5.0, and vibrant RGB lighting with four fans plus an RGB mouse and keyboard, it offers a complete, future-ready setup running Windows 11 Home.

It is a good computer... to a point
Edit: The hard drive bricked today. It is no longer seen by BIOS. I will happily edit this review again should the resolution be favorable. For under $900 this is a great computer. It has a decent GPU, excellent amounts of RAM, plenty of storage. I am having an odd issue loading websites, regardless of browser. It isn't my internet connection because I still have my old computer and they load much faster on that little mini-PC. So that is odd. I'm not sure what to make on that. The computer CANNOT be upgraded to Windows 11, so when Microsoft officially dumps Windows 10, throw it out. Take some time to save your money to get a higher end PC. The mouse pad, is nice. I'm not using the keyboard, mouse, or sound bar at this time, so I have no comment on those. The headphones are uncomfortable as can be! It came with several dongles. I believe one is for the wifi issues this model was having, but I have no clue what the other one was for as it came with no explanation and was separate from any of the other accessory packaging. I do suggest caution as the way the computer was shipped was a bit scary. The box the PC was in, and all the accessories, was put into a bigger box with no filler. This allowed the interior box to bounce around, and I'm surprised it arrived intact and fully functioning. Don't be cheep on packing materials! All in all it is a nice computer and plays games great! So odd about the website thing though.

Satisfied
My 17 yo daughter wanted a gaming set up and as a single parent I was on a budget. After spending countless hours researching the type of specs that were necessary to play the kind of games she does, I continued my search throughout the internet for an affordable option. Although hesitant to purchase from Amazon in case we ran into any issues or it needed to be returned, I took a risk after reading reviews on Amazon, YouTube and other sources. Arrival: It arrived in a huge box, upon opening there was the setup encased in another box and some filler paper. I opened up the setup and it was packaged to my satisfaction. Everything came in their own little boxes and the tower even had foam inside to prevent any small pieces from breaking during transport. It came with all the extras as guaranteed. Set up: I’m tech friendly enough to configure setup, but it was pretty simple to me that I believe a non experienced person can do it as instructions were printed on the tower where/where not to plug the components. Everything was included (minus the monitor) and I was able to connect the monitor, mouse and speaker for use. Use of setup: The tower is very nice when the lights are turned on and you can even control the colors with an included remote. Some things to consider is the tower includes USB components for Bluetooth and WiFi, I knew this upon purchasing. I personally didn’t have trouble with either and the computer connected to our WiFi just fine. I wasn’t too worried in case by chance it didn’t because I had an Ethernet cable on hand but thankfully it wasn’t necessary. This computer is not meant to be upgraded to Windows 11, I also knew this before purchasing. I figured for the price I couldn’t complain and can do any part upgrades needed in a year or two. No problems running Windows so far. Overall: My daughter is happy so in turn I am happy. We’ve only had the setup for two weeks and so far no problems, I hope this is continuous. great gpu & ram, bad wifi/bt cards
great pc, great deal, top quality gaming, high fps, looks cool, great GPU, lots of RAM, blazing fast, lots of fans. the biggest issue is that the processor is not compatible with Windows 11, so we'll have to upgrade the processor in a few years. but the other components are very high spec'd for the price. the peripherals: good keyboard and mouse; good headphones, but usb would've been better; ok sound bar, but the connector for it is meh; bad wifi and bt cards, i didn't like them. i connected the pc directly to ethernet. connection wasn't that good via the included wifi card, at least not for real-time multi-player AAA gaming. if you need high quality WiFi, I'd suggest getting anothe card separately, not relying on the one that comes with this pc. despite all this, $800 for an rtx3060 desktop with 32G of RAM is a VERY good deal. it's a really fast gaming pc
